what does this mean? you can´t update the dumpdates file when dumping a subdirectory

Re: strange dumperror message

2004-02-27 Thread Joshua Baker-LePain
On Fri, 27 Feb 2004 at 3:55pm, pascal thomas wrote > what does this mean? > you can´t update the dumpdates file when dumping a subdirectory > You're using dump and your disklist entry is not a partition. You can't do it. Either dump partitions only or use tar. -- Joshua Baker-LePain Departme
